Diogo Dalloz

Diogo Dalloz work process

Diogo Dalloz is a unique jeweler, with a gallery in Porto where he currently lives. Diogo has a degree in “Jewellery Design”, and a Masters in Product Design with an orientation on Jewellery Design, obtained by the School of Arts and Design of Matosinhos. His works are undescribable art pieces therefore since 2011 he has participated in numerous of prestigious international exhibitions such as “NY Design Week”, “Rio + Design 2013” and “Rio + Design Milan 2014”. Vitor Agostinho

Vitor Agostinho work process

Vítor Agostinho is a designer with relevant experience in the ceramics industry. As a result of his investigation in this area, he orients his work towards the personalization and self-production. This two dimensions, mass, and self-production, granted him the unique opportunity to develop new methods of forming his art pieces. Some of his best works will be presented at LDC Summit 2019.

Olga Santa Bárbara

Olga Santa Bárbara

Olga Santa Bárbara is a master in conservation and restoration. She is the owner of Oficinas Santa Bárbara workshops established, in 1999, in Matosinhos area. The main purpose of which is to support the Conservation and Restoration of Art’s in the Northern Region of Portugal. This institution is unique by its nature, it trains experts and talented master artisans, dedicated to hand painting and restoration. Great gilded and polychrome wood carving pieces, paintings over canvas and wood, sculpture, wall, and ceiling covering pieces of this talented artist will be presented on LDC Summit 2019.
